Elisabeth Hasselbeck on The View: Her Best Moments & Latest News

Elisabeth Hasselbeck became a familiar face on daytime television through her role on ABC's The View, blending relatable humor with candid political discussion. Her time on the show positioned her as both a connector and a commentator in national debates.

Across seasons, Hasselbeck balanced personal storytelling with sharp cultural observations, making The View a platform where politics, lifestyle, and entertainment intersected in real time.

Political Discourse On The View

Hasselbeck consistently framed political conversations in terms that invited viewers in rather than shutting them out. Her willingness to ask basic questions helped complex policies feel accessible.

Balancing Ideologies

On set, she navigated contrasts between liberal and conservative perspectives, often modeling how to disagree without personal attacks. This approach shaped how political talk shows approached audience engagement.

Daytime Television Style

Unlike evening news, The View emphasized personality and interaction, and Hasselbeck thrived in that environment. Her humor and self awareness made intense segments feel more approachable.

Lifestyle Integration

Segments on health, family, and work life often featured Hasselbeck sharing stories that connected political issues to everyday experiences. This blend reinforced the show's mix of information and entertainment.

Audience Connection And Legacy

Viewers responded to her authenticity, especially when she admitted uncertainty or shared personal missteps. That openness contributed to a lasting public memory that extended beyond her years on air.
